what kind of efficiency am i supposed to be getting out of a classic mag running a 68 4500 psi air tank? right now i am getting anywhere from 600-800 shots on it.

For best efficiency don't shoot over 280 fps. Use the shortest level 10 spring. Use an unported 11" barrel. I actually use a 12" with very small porting and get over 1100 shots on a 68-4500 and the small ports make it very quiet without sacrificing efficiency.

I get around 1000 rounds off of a 70/4500 tank (tank only filled to 4000 psi) running at around 250-260 fps. I play indoor mostly, so I have to stay at the lower velocities.
